Has anyone ever had to bend aircon lines?

Im doing turbo mods to my Patrol na I need to bend at least one aircon line to make stuff fit.

The lines are still gassed and on the car.
Basicallym If I can bend them on the car and it doesent leak, WIN. No expense required.
If I bend them and they split, or leak otherwise, well, getting a custom pipe made up was inevitable anyways so I dont really have much to lose by having a go.

Anyone have any tricks?
SUre I could just pull on the lines until they are at the right spot, but should I crack out the oxy to help a bit to avoid kinks or what ever.
